Covering all industries from manufacturing to construction, this comprehensive reference book provides quick answers to complicated questions about compliance obligations under the Occupational Safety and Health Act and Title 29 of the Code of Federal Regulations. You’ll find plain-English explanations for questions about the Act’s general and industry-specific standards; inspections; and training, recordkeeping, and reporting requirements.
